Create a DTD which describes the structure of the document which you prepared in Question 1. Make sure that you use all appropriate DTD ingredients to constrain valid documents as much as possible.
Make sure that your DTD has the following two features:
(a) Use IDREFs in your DTD to include more data about users and refer to those users elsewhere in doc; and
(b) Your DTD should contain one or more parameter entities.
You should modify your XML document from Question 1 such that it now contains a reference to the DTD schema. Include in your submission a screenshot that proves that your instance document is valid over the DTD. For example, if you use xmllint in Linux, take a screenshot of the start of the output. As an aother example, if you use an editor such as Blue?sh, take a screenshot after you have run the DTD validation.
